What do you understand about the YouTube tag?
Creators can add descriptive YouTube tags to their videos to make it easier for viewers to find their material. YouTube tags are pieces of metadata that YouTube’s algorithm needs in addition to your video’s thumbnail, title, and description to determine your video’s theme and aid in its discovery. Topics, categories, and even prominent businesses can be included in a YouTube tag. When users type keywords into the YouTube search field, it becomes easier for viewers to find content the more information a creator includes on a video.

What are the benefits of YouTube tags for videos?
More people are likely to locate and watch your YouTube videos if you carefully choose the tags you use. Suppose a viewer requests a review of the McDonald’s menu items. Food reviewers who use the hashtags #McDonald or #FastFood will increase the likelihood that their videos will be found.
Instructions for adding tags to Youtube videos
1. Create a new YouTube upload
Click the camera icon next to your profile picture. A drop-down menu will appear. Click Upload Video to start a new upload.
2. Choose a video to upload
Drag and drop video files to upload or select your video through files.
3. Name your video, add description and tags
Before you can start adding YouTube tags to your videos, you must fill in a video title and description. Next, click the Show more button to see the YouTube video tag option. Add 5-8 related YouTube tags and separate tags with commas. Save your video when you’re ready to publish.
